SadaNews - The General Secretariat of the Organization of Islamic Cooperation has strongly condemned Israel's announcement, as an occupying power, to appoint a diplomatic envoy in what is referred to as (the Somaliland region) located in the northwestern part of the Federal Republic of Somalia, considering this a violation of the sovereignty of the Federal Republic of Somalia, its national unity, and territorial integrity.

The General Secretariat reaffirmed its full solidarity with the Federal Republic of Somalia and its unwavering support for its sovereignty and territorial integrity, as well as its absolute endorsement of its legitimate institutions. It also emphasized the need to adhere to the principles and charter of the United Nations and international law, all of which call for the respect of the sovereignty and territorial integrity of member states.
